The One Page Covering Letter


I can’t stress enough to you the importance of a good covering letter. Let’s begin by taking a moment to consider the start of the hiring process.
The person reading your letter (and that could be either a recruiter, hiring manager or an HR Professional), may be reviewing hundreds of CV’s and you are going to get about 30 seconds (at most), to ensure that the hirer remembers you and short lists your CV.
Your covering letter is therefore setting the tone of your application, so make sure you make the very best impression you can.
Here are some suggestions on structure and content for letter:-
1st paragraph
Your 1st paragraph should explain the purpose of your letter. It should be clear and concise and may read:
'I would like to be considered for the position of ‘XYZ advertised on/in (here you could name the source of the advertisement)’.
2nd paragraph
Clearly state why you feel you are suitable for the role. Briefly outline your work experience and academic qualifications and your relevant skills. Do not be tempted to add lots of information here that is not relevant to the role. Only mention skills which are relevant to this particular role.
Yes, you do need a specific covering letter for each application. Specific applications are written by people who REALLY want that job!
3rd paragraph
Outline your career goal, ideally making it relevant to the position you’re applying for, and expand on the pertinent points in your CV. Let the hirer know what you could bring to their company. Don’t turn it into “War and Peace”, it simply won't get read.
Final paragraph
This is your opportunity to reiterate your interest in and suitability to the role and your availability for interview.
To summarise; keep it brief, keep it concise and make it relevant to each recipient you send your CV to.

The SME business challenge... recruiting new staff



The SME business challenge... recruiting new staff



For any SME increasing staff numbers is a massive decision, but in your heart, you know that it’s the only way forward if you want to grow your business. So, here are my tips to help you successfully recruit.

Be clear on the job and person specification…
Take time to write a full job and person specification, list the key tasks you would like your new employee to deal with and think about the skills required to complete those tasks successfully.  There are numerous benefits to having a clear and concise job description, not least of which is it will help you measure your new employees performance in their role.
Decide on the hours needed, salary and benefits.

Cultural fit for your business…………
You will ascertain during your skills based interview, candidate testing and references, if your candidate can do the specific tasks required for the role.

As an SME business owner you’ll be acutely aware of the importance of “culture- fit” when bringing in a new team member and you will need to ascertain this during the interview process by asking questions about values, principles and team ethic.

Don’t forget to sell the merits of working for your business......
Your business is your universe, but in the eyes of a candidate, you may be an unknown quantity. You need to pitch your potential growth and promote any non-financial benefits of working for your business e.g. flexible work arrangements. When you are reviewing candidates, look closely at candidates who have worked for other SMEs or who have established their own businesses and are looking to come back into the workplace. You want people who are happy to get their hands dirty, have a hint of entrepreneurial spirit, or have no interest in working for large organisations. 

Temporary, contract or permanent to start with?.............
Hiring someone as a contractor or temporary employee to start with can be a smart move to ensure that, firstly, the new recruit can do the job, but also fits with the culture of your workplace. It also allows employers to test a flexible work arrangement before creating a more permanent position.  However, if a candidate is already in a permanent role they are unlikely to accept an offer of contract or temporary work from you and in this instance you would need to make an permanent job offer to attract that candidate into your business.


Most of the time, candidates will work with a contract/temporary role as long as there is a view to the role becoming permanent. Do, keep in mind that candidates may continue to consider other permanent options whilst they are working with you as most people’s priority is a permanent job.
Many employers are also happy to hire someone upfront in a permanent position. Most candidates are naturally attracted to permanent roles because it provides a sense of job security. If your business is established, there is sufficient work, and you require someone with skills that your business doesn’t have, permanent roles provide the opportunity for someone to come into the business with a medium to long term outlook.
